                             Mathematical Genius





        Do you like to play with numbers? Solving number games helps to sharpen your brain. Let us have

        some fun with numbers.

        Let’s solve the following.

          1.  If + means ÷, × means –, – means ×, and ÷ means +, then 38 + 19 – 16 × 17 ÷ 3 = ?

               a.  16                  b. 19                    c. 18                   d. 12


          2.  If a means +, b means –, c means ×, and d means ÷, then 18c 14a 6b 16d 4 = ?

               a.  63                  b. 254                   c. 288                  d. 1208

          3.  If A means +, B means –, C means ×, D means ÷, then solve 100D 20C 3A 10B 5 = ?


               a.  15                  b. 25                    c. 30                   d. 20

          4.   If ÷ means ×, – means +, × means –, and + means ÷, then what will be the value of 20 + 4 × 6 – 5
              ÷ 7 = ?


               a.  28                  b. 32                    c. 34                   d. 36

          5.   If P means ×, Q means ÷, R means +, and S means –, then what is the value of 154Q 14S 7P 3R 25
              = ?

               a.  35                  b. 57                    c. 42                   d. 15


          6.   If P$Q means divide, P#Q means subtract, P%Q means add, P@Q means multiply, then 70# 30%
              80$ 20@ 10 = ?

               a.  60                  b. 80                    c. 20                   d. 10











                    Fact File
                   t
                    Aryabhata  from  ancient  history  was  the  first  person  to  figure  out  that  the  moon  and
                    planets shine due to reflected sunlight. He also calculated the closest approximate value
                    of pi during that time and contributed to the fields of Algebra and Trigonometry.
